Learner's permit
Getting your learner's permit is a crucial step on the road towards driving independence. It is essential to prepare and be aware of the procedure. To prepare, make sure that you have all the necessary documents in order to avoid having to wait at the DMV office. New York's website has an extensive guide for permits that can save you time by providing clear documentation requirements and confirming eligibility requirements. It is also beneficial to read the New York State Driver's Manual and take a test prior to your official exam.
When you arrive at the DMV, make sure that you have completed the application form as well as evidence of your identity and age, original Social Security Card, and proof of residency (e.g. utility bills or bank statements). You will also be required to pass a vision test and a written test. The written test comprises 20 multiple-choice questions, and you must answer at least 14 correctly in order to pass. You can increase your chances of success by reading the New York State Driver's Manual and preparing with online practice tests.

Vision test
The vision test is a crucial element of obtaining a driver's license. The test evaluates your ability to see clearly at close and far distances. It also identifies blind spots or gaps in your field of vision and assesses your eye movements as well as coordination. The results are compared to standards to determine if your vision is normal. The test is usually conducted at a doctor's office, but it may be conducted at health fairs sponsored by local communities or fraternal groups such as the Lions and Elks clubs.
There are a variety of vision tests. Some check for refractive errors, which occur when your eye is formed in the wrong way, which doesn't allow light to focus on the retina properly. Other tests look for the sensitivity to glare, color vision, and depth perception. Vision tests can also identify eye conditions such as glaucoma or macular degeneration.
In the most popular vision test, your doctor puts a chart in front you with a series of symbols or letters that get progressively smaller as you move down the page. The smallest size letter you can read correctly will determine your visual acuity. A visual field test is a form of test for vision that tests for gaps in peripheral (side) vision.

Road test
A road test is an essential milestone for new drivers. It is not only an assessment of the driving skills, but also a quality assurance process that guarantees that future drivers can drive the streets in New York City safely. This test can be challenging, but with proper preparation, you can get the best result.
Prior to taking your NY driver's test, it is a good idea to read the New York State Driver's Manual. The manual covers the entire spectrum of safe driving, including traffic laws, lane markings and the operation of a vehicle. It can be downloaded from the official website of the Department of Motor Vehicles, and it is essential to read it carefully so that you comprehend its contents.

During the road test, you will be required to perform various maneuvers, such as parallel parking and three-point turn. The examiner will also test your ability to merge onto highways and perform lane changes. Be aware and follow the speed limit. You should practice these techniques prior to your road test. This will help you prepare for the real-world scenarios you will encounter during your test.
